dont lie about your weight with the anesthesiologist. probably the scariest thing pre surgery is when they hand you the form that says if needed is it ok to give a blood transfusion. my smart ass wanted to say if i was worried about dying why would i be having this surgery?
post surgery - listen to your doctor and your Physical therapists. do not think you have to over achieve in the rehab. also if something feels off, tell them dont bottle it up. if they give you an epidural remember this part. you will not poop for 1.5 to 3 days. when you finally drob a deuce stay on the toilet for an extra 5-10 minutes. after not pooping for so long and then you finally do your body loses a lot of hydration and you will be close to passing out. let that feeling pass before moving.
